Safety diagnosis device for measuring the depth of carbonation and testing of chloride content in concrete structures and method using same

The present invention relates to a safety diagnosis apparatus and method for measuring the carbonation depth of a concrete structure and a chloride content test, comprising: a main body having a through hole through which a drill bit passes and having a coupling part at one end; Forming a guide passage through which the drill bit passes, an opening is formed by a predetermined first angle in the circumferential direction, a rotatable guide member is provided, and an accommodation space is provided between the main body and the main body. And a revolver case coupled to one end; A plurality of sample chambers including a first sample chamber and a second sample chamber selectively communicating with the opening according to a rotation angle of the guide member are provided, a through hole through which the drill bit passes is formed, and in the receiving space a sample collector to be accommodated; It provides a safety diagnosis device for the measurement of the carbonation depth of the concrete structure and the chloride content test, which is configured to accurately collect concrete powder for each predetermined depth of the concrete structure and store it conveniently by location.
